Gerold Krause-Junk (* 1936 ) is a German economist and emeritus professor of finance at the University of Hamburg .

Life

Gerold Krause-Junk received his doctorate in 1965 from the Faculty of Economics and Social Sciences at the Free University of Berlin . The subject of his dissertation was government spending, income levels and economic structure. Circular theoretical considerations on the effects of public spending . From 1965 to 1966 Krause-Junk studied abroad as a guest of the faculty at the Massachusetts Institute of Technology (MIT) in the United States of America (USA).

In 1969 he achieved his habilitation at the University of Hamburg . The subject of his habilitation thesis was The Allocation Optimum and the Principle of Equivalence of Taxation . From 1969 to 1983 Gerold Krause-Junk was Professor of Public Finance at the Free University of Berlin . From 1983 to 2002 he was Professor of Public Finance at the University of Hamburg. Krause-Junk has retired since 2002.

Gerold Krause-Junk is currently (as of January 2015) a member of the Scientific Advisory Board at the Federal Ministry of Finance , of which he was Chairman from 1995 to 1998. In the 2013 summer semester, Krause-Junk is the holder of the 14th Johannes Gutenberg Endowed Professorship at Johannes Gutenberg University Mainz .

Research priorities

His research interests and areas were welfare theory , tax policy and international financial order.
